 This Is TASTE 396: Robert Sietsema & Luke Pyenson
 May 1, 2024 
 Food writers Robert Sietsema and Luke Pyenson discuss NYC's culinary landscape, immigrant food culture, evolution of food journalism, music influences on food, and diverse culinary adventures, including Arab cuisine in Dearborn and touring experiences. They also touch on favorite restaurants, cookbooks, band meals, and retirement plans.
